The Historical Roots of Acupuncture and Meridian Theory
Acupuncture, with its intricate network of meridians, has deep historical roots that map back hundreds of years in ancient China.
You'll find that very early messages, like the Huangdi Neijing, laid the foundation for understanding how energy moves via the body. These writings presented the concept of Qi, the vital energy that circulates along the meridians.
As you discover this old technique, you'll find exactly how practitioners recognized specific points to affect health and balance.
Over centuries, acupuncture progressed, including different strategies and approaches, yet it remained deeply linked to its beginnings.
Scientific Perspectives on Acupuncture Things
While many individuals still check out acupuncture as an old art rooted in custom, clinical research has increasingly clarified the physiological devices behind acupuncture points.
Researches recommend these points may correspond to locations rich in nerve endings, capillary, and connective tissues. When needles promote these factors, they can activate biochemical responses, such as the release of endorphins and other natural chemicals, which assist alleviate discomfort and advertise healing.
Imaging strategies like functional MRI have actually shown changes in brain activity associated with acupuncture, sustaining its effectiveness.
While hesitation continues to be, expanding evidence indicate a possible biological basis for acupuncture, inviting additional expedition into exactly how these old practices can align with modern clinical understanding.
